Description |
Title from item or material accompanying item.; Handwritten on item back: Henry Clay Barnabee "Pinafore" Sir Joseph Porter; Warren's Portraits, 465 Washington St., Boston; Date supplied by cataloger.; Henry Clay Barnabee played Sir Joseph Porter in the Boston Ideal Opera Company's production of "H. M. S. Pinafore" in Boston in 1879. |
